Question
susie finished preparing a dish for a dinner party being held the next day. what step should she take to store the food properly?
use (aluminum) foil to cover the food dish.
leave the food out on the counter until the next day.
use a container that is at least six inches deep.
put leftovers in a container filled less than two inches deep.
Leaving food out on the counter is unsafe due to bacteria growth. A deep - container may not cool food quickly enough. Using aluminum foil alone may not be sufficient for long - term storage. Putting leftovers in a container filled less than two inches deep allows for quicker cooling and safer storage.
